Constipation

Constipation is a condition which affects the digestive system, during it the patient is unable to defecate. This may happen due to many possible factors. Among them are:

  • Decreased fiber intake
  • Dehydration
  • Medication effect: diuretics, opioid analgesic use, tricyclic antidepressant use
  • Metal poisoning
  • Decreased or absent peristaltic action
  • Gastrointestinal tumors
  • Abdominal surgery

Constipation is considered a serious problem as it may affect any individual. For people without corresponding pathologies the simplest treatment is change of the diet and increase of physical exercise. Other possible treatment is use of such medicines as laxative stimulants which work by increasing peristalsis and thus increasing the speed of food passage.

On the other hand if a pathology is present constipation may even require surgery. If you feel that you are constipated please consult your doctor and if no serious pathology would be found you will be prescribed the simplest way to relieve the condition.
